How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Sunrise Heights?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Sunrise Heights Studio Apartments | $1,912 | $1,499 | $2,291 |
Sunrise Heights 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,192 | $1,450 | $2,947 |
Sunrise Heights 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,529 | $1,790 | $4,036 |
Sunrise Heights 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,289 | $2,600 | $4,106 |
Sunrise Heights 4 Bedroom Apartments | $3,550 | $3,300 | $3,800 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Sunrise Heights
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Sunrise Heights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Sunrise Heights ranges from $1,450 to $2,947 with an average monthly rent of $2,192.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Sunrise Heights c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Sunrise Heights range from $1,790 to $4,036.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,529.
How expensive are Sunrise Heights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 7 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Sunrise Heights on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$2,600 to $4,106 - averaging $3,289 for the location.
